8 Sectoral system - basic principles Only applicable to specific professions/titles mentioned in Annex V Certificate of correspondence Art 23(6) Specialisation has to exist in at least 2/5 of MS - other MS apply general system (C-16/99 Erpelding) Automatic recognition of diploma (not substantive but formal assessment!) Minimum harmonisation of training in EEA if not fulfilled: Acquired rights principle (Arts 23, 27, 30) if not fulfilled: Article 10: general system applies (with adaptations, see Article 14(3) paragraph 2)
9 2.2 General system basic principles (1) Professions not covered by sectoral system Horizontal recognition based on 5 levels of qualification (Article 11) Not EQF (for non-regulated professions)! No harmonisation 2 compensation measures to choose from (derogation 14(2)): - aptitude test - adaptation period Partial recognition of qualifications (C-330/03 Colegio de Ingenieros)
10 Case C-330/03 Colegio de Ingenieros whether the competent authorities of host state are precluded by the Directive from partly allowing that application [ ] by limiting the scope of the permission to the activities which that diploma allows to be taken up in the home State? The wording, scheme and objectives of the Directive do not preclude the possibility of partial taking-up of a regulated profession, except activity cannot objectively be separated from the rest of the activities compensation measures are sufficient to fill gaps consumer protection cannot be guaranteed

14 4.1 Language requirements "Persons benefiting from the recognition of professional qualifications shall have a knowledge of languages necessary for practising the profession in the host Member State (Article 53) Language requirement is not part of recognition procedure, except if language is integral part of profession (e.g. speech therapist, teacher, ) It has only effect with regard to actual pursuit of profession Applicable for establishment and service provision
15 Summary of case law of the ECJ Choice of control of language knowledge is left to host state No universal/systematic language test (proportionality) Not only national language tests have to be accepted Linguistic knowledge necessary for exercise of profession - unclear Take into account official minorities with different language (ECJ Cases 379/87 Groener, C-424/97 Haim II, C-281/98 Angonese, C-193/05 Commission vs Luxembourg, C- 506/04 Wilson)

Flexibility of service providers Definition of service (Article 5(2)): pursuit of the profession on a temporal and occasional basis with individual assessment based on duration, frequency, regularity and continuity Application of definition in practise Nature of service Permanent infrastructure (C-55/94 Gebhard) Intention of circumvention (205/84 Van Binsbergen, C-23/93 TV 10) Service entirely or principally directed towards host state Intention of migrant
17 Requirements of service provision Simple prior declaration to host state of intention to provide service (Article 7(1)) Article 7(4) exceptions of public health and safety Short deadline - if missed, service can be performed! If aptitude test - service provided under title of host state! No formal registration with professional associations or organisations or public social security bodies (Article 6) only pro forma Service provided under title of home state (Article 7(3)) Person subject to host state disciplinary measures
18 5.1 PQ Directive vs Services Directive Complementary instruments regulating different issues PQD: Education and qualifications SD: Commercial communications (authorisation), professional liability insurance, multidisciplinary activities, administrative simplification, etc Addressees SD addresses a service provider (company or person) PQD addresses a person as service provider
19 Regulated profession Definition: professions directly or indirectly regulated by laws, regulations or administrative procedures Definition is a matter of Community law (C-164/94 Aranitis, C-313/01 Morgenbesser, C-234/97 Bobadilla, C- 285/07 Burbaud) Not activities constituting practical part of training necessary for access to a profession (C-313/01 Morgenbesser) Not when access to a profession is based on comparative assessment rather than by application of absolute criteria (C-586/08 Rubino) Regulated profession addresses education/qualification necessary to actually perform the activity ( know how - e.g. electrician, doctor, etc)
20 Regulated activity No clear criteria of distinction to regulated profession (see ECJ Cases 458/08 and C-203/11 (Q8) concerning construction sector) Regulated activity addresses rather the circumstances under which an activity is performed alcohol selling license manager

22 7. Third country diplomas - definition EU diploma in general system - Article 1 i.c.w. Article 3(1)(c): Diploma delivered in EU Member State and training mainly obtained in the Community EU diploma for sectoral system - ECJ Case C-110/01 Tennah-Durez: Diploma delivered in EU Member State
23 Third country diplomas - recognition MS may recognise 3 rd country diploma under its own national rules. Professions of sectoral system have to fulfil minimum requirements (Article 2(2)) Diploma of 3 rd country has to be recognised in another MS, if holder has three years professional experience in first MS (Article 3(3)) General system applies (Article 10(g)) Sectoral system never applies to 3 rd country diplomas If no 3 years professional experience in first MS, then case has to be assessed on general provisions of EEA Agreement (ECJ case C-238/98 Hocsman) Compare knowledge and abilities certified by the diploma with requirements of national rules Recognise experience and training in MS and 3rd country - proportionality Migrant cannot make use of rights for services provision (Articles 5-9)
